Oracle Cerner Awarded Veterans Affairs Electronic Health Records Contract
Cerner Corporation has been awarded the contract for the Department of Veterans Affairs electronic health record system, the VA announced yesterday. Dr. David J. Shulkin, VA Secretary, said that by adopting the same EHR as the Department of Defense, all patient data will reside in one common system, improving interoperability and data sharing between […]

Survey: Epic Identified as Most Satisfactory EHR System
Epic was ranked the most satisfactory EHR system in a survey conducted by Healthcare IT News. The survey, which polled IT managers, physicians and clinician end-users, measured EHR systems based on visual appearance, user experience, interoperability, quality of installation support, quality of ongoing support, and overall satisfaction.
